3. Setup
Follow these steps to set up your Geeni Look camera and connect it to your Wi-Fi network.
What's in the Box:
- Smart Wi-Fi Security Camera
- Mounting Adhesive
- USB Cable
- Power Adapter
- User Manual (this document)
Installation Steps:
- Download the Geeni App: Search for "Geeni" in the App Store (iOS) or Google Play Store (Android) and download the application.
- Create an Account: Open the Geeni app and follow the on-screen instructions to register a new account or log in if you already have one.
- Power On the Camera: Connect the provided USB cable to the camera's Micro USB input and the power adapter. Plug the adapter into a wall outlet. The camera's indicator light will begin to flash, indicating it's ready for pairing.
- Add Device in App: In the Geeni app, tap the "+" icon in the top right corner to add a new device. Select "Video Camera" or the specific Geeni Look model.
- Connect to Wi-Fi: Follow the in-app instructions to connect your camera to your 2.4GHz Wi-Fi network. Ensure your phone is connected to the same 2.4GHz network during setup. The app may prompt you to scan a QR code displayed on your phone with the camera lens.
- Position the Camera: Use the flexible stem and adhesive base to mount or place the camera in your desired location. Adjust the angle for optimal viewing.

6.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your Geeni Look camera, refer to the following common problems and solutions.
Camera Not Connecting to Wi-Fi:
- Ensure your Wi-Fi network is 2.4GHz. The camera does not support 5GHz networks.
- Check your Wi-Fi password for accuracy.
- Move the camera closer to your Wi-Fi router to improve signal strength.
- Restart your Wi-Fi router and the camera.
- If using a QR code for setup, ensure the camera lens is clean and the QR code is well-lit and clearly displayed on your phone screen.
Night Vision Not Activating/Switching:
- Ensure there are no obstructions directly in front of the camera lens that might interfere with the infrared sensors.
- Check if the camera is in a dimly lit area that might confuse its light sensor.
Poor Video Quality:
- Check your internet connection speed. A stable and fast connection is required for 1080p streaming.
- Ensure the camera lens is clean.
- Reduce the video quality setting in the Geeni app if your internet speed is inconsistent.
Two-Way Audio Issues:
- Ensure your phone's microphone and speaker permissions are enabled for the Geeni app.
- Check the volume levels on both your phone and within the app.
- Avoid placing the camera in noisy environments that might interfere with audio clarity.

7. Specifications
| Feature | Detail |
|---|---|
| Model Name | LOOK 1080p HD |
| Video Capture Resolution | 1080p |
| Indoor/Outdoor Usage | Indoor |
| Connectivity Technology | Wireless (Wi-Fi) |
| Wireless Communication Technology | Wi-Fi (2.4GHz only) |
| Power Source | AC |
| Controller Type | Amazon Alexa, Android, Google Assistant, iOS |
| Special Feature | 2-Way Audio, Night Vision, Motion Detection |
| Field Of View | 120 Degrees |
| Storage | MicroSD card (up to 128GB), Cloud Storage (optional) |
| Dimensions (L x W x H) | 2.25 x 2.25 x 4.5 inches |
| Item Weight | 1.76 ounces |
| Material |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ene (ABS) |
